Animal Rights Activist Captured After 20-Year Manhunt

from Terrorist Threat Tracker - United States · host Inception Point AI

An individual who has been on the United States' most-wanted terrorist list for nearly two decades due to their alleged involvement in animal-rights extremism was recently arrested in the United Kingdom. The arrest marks a significant moment in a long-standing international pursuit involving various law enforcement agencies. This person catapulted into notoriety for their association with radical animal rights groups, believed to be responsible for a series of high-profile, disruptive actions aiming at institutions they accused of animal cruelty. These acts, ranging from vandalism to threats against employees of targeted institutions, escalated in their intensity and frequency, eventually gaining the attention of the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I). In 2009, a terrorism poster was distributed with their image by the FBI, identifying them as a key suspect in ongoing investigations related to domestic terrorism linked to animal rights activism. The label of 'terrorism' was attributed to the methods and intents expressed in their acts, which pushed beyond simple protest to what authorities evaluated as attempts to coerce and instill fear for political gains in the name of animal rights. The former FBI Counterterrorism Assistant Director, involved during the period of heightened activities by this individual and similar groups, underscored the complexities of tackling ideologically motivated crimes which often blur the lines between lawful protest and criminal actions. The arrest in the UK was executed after rigorous cross-border law enforcement cooperation, highlighting the global nature of the U.S.'s counterterrorism efforts. Details regarding the extradition processes are still pending, as legal proceedings have to consider the specific charges and the nature of the alleged crimes committed. This case rekindles discussions on the scope of activism and the point at which it crosses the line into terrorism, a debate that remains as pertinent today as it was when the chase for this activist began. The definition and handling of "eco-terrorism" continue to evolve, reflecting broader societal debates about environmental and animal-rights ethics, the scope of activism, and governmental responses to such issues. As such, this arrest is not merely the conclusion of a law enforcement pursuit but is also likely to stimulate important conversations about law, morality, and the means of advocating for change.
